Skip to content

fix: MatteNode背景コピーのViewPortオフセット適用漏れ修正#310

Merged
ainyan03 merged 1 commit into
mainfrom
claude/fleximg-mattenode-bg-offset-fix
Feb 7, 2026
Merged

fix: MatteNode背景コピーのViewPortオフセット適用漏れ修正#310
ainyan03 merged 1 commit into
mainfrom
claude/fleximg-mattenode-bg-offset-fix

Conversation

@ainyan03
Copy link
Copy Markdown
Owner

@ainyan03 ainyan03 commented Feb 7, 2026

Summary

  • MatteNodeで背景(bg)が非アフィン状態(ViewPortにx,yオフセットあり)の場合、先頭行の内容が全ラインに適用される描画バグを修正
  • 背景コピーループの行アドレス計算に bgViewPort.x, bgViewPort.y オフセットを加算
  • CHANGELOG.md に修正内容を追記

Test plan

  • ネイティブテスト全件パス(160テストケース、67718アサーション)
  • WASMリリースビルド成功
  • WASMデバッグビルド成功
  • デモで背景が非アフィン状態のMatteNode描画が正しく表示されることを確認済み

bgが非アフィン状態(ViewPortにx,yオフセットあり)の場合、
先頭行の内容が全ラインに適用される描画不具合を修正。
@ainyan03 ainyan03 merged commit 143f655 into main Feb 7, 2026
5 checks passed
@ainyan03 ainyan03 deleted the claude/fleximg-mattenode-bg-offset-fix branch February 7, 2026 23:32
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ant